What are Layer-2 Solutions?
Layer-2 solutions refer to protocols built on top of an existing blockchain (referred to as layer-1) to enhance transaction throughput and reduce congestion. They operate independently, processing transactions off the main chain while ensuring that the security and decentralization of the blockchain remain intact.
Why Are Layer-2 Solutions Needed?
As blockchain networks like Bitcoin and Ethereum grow in popularity, the number of transactions increases significantly. This can lead to slow processing times and high transaction fees. Layer-2 solutions address these issues by paving the way for faster and cheaper transactions, thereby improving the user experience and expanding the possibilities for decentralized applications (dApps).
How Layer-2 Solutions Work
Layer-2 solutions function by allowing transactions to be executed off the main blockchain, which conserves capacity. Once transactions are completed, they can be bundled and submitted back to the main chain in a single transaction. Some popular layer-2 solutions include:
- State Channels: This method allows two parties to transact off-chain, maintaining only the initial and final states on the blockchain, significantly reducing the number of transactions recorded on-chain.
- Plasma: A framework that enables the creation of child chains which can execute transactions independently while relying on the security of the main blockchain.
- Rollups: This technique involves aggregating multiple transactions into a single batch and submitting it to the main chain. Rollups can be either optimistic or zero-knowledge, depending on how they validate transactions.
Benefits of Layer-2 Solutions
The primary benefits of implementing layer-2 solutions include:
- Increased Transaction Speed: Layer-2 solutions can process thousands of transactions per second, significantly enhancing the throughput of blockchain networks.
- Reduced Costs: By minimizing the number of transactions that need to be recorded on the main chain, users experience lower fees, making blockchain more accessible to everyday users.
- Improved User Experience: Faster transaction confirmations lead to a more seamless experience for users interacting with dApps.
- Enhanced Scalability: These solutions allow blockchain networks to expand without compromising security, catering to the growing demand for decentralized applications.
Challenges and Considerations
Despite the numerous advantages of layer-2 solutions, there are challenges that need to be addressed. Solutions like state channels and plasma require users to lock up funds, which can lead to liquidity concerns. Moreover, decentralization may be compromised in some layer-2 solutions, depending on their design. It's crucial for developers to balance scalability with security and decentralization as they implement these solutions.
